The highly-anticipated Android messaging app, Beeper Mini, is finally here. However, many eager users attempting to install and get started with the app are encountering a significant roadblock: error code DF-DFERH-01.

Beeper Mini bridges the gap between Android and Apple's messaging platforms, allowing its users to engage in iMessage Group Chats while embracing the iconic blue bubbles associated with Apple's messaging service. But one obstacle remains to be addressed.

How to fix error code DF-DFERH-01 in Beeper Mini

To fix error code DF-DFERH-01 encountered during your attempt to initiate the Beeper Mini free trial, it's advisable to retry the process during off-peak hours, as the servers are currently likely to be experiencing high demand.

By "off-peak hours," it means times when fewer users are likely to be accessing the service, typically outside of standard daytime or early evening hours in most time zones. Generally, 12 AM to 4 AM is a good time frame to try.

These periods often see reduced traffic on digital platforms, potentially leading to less strain on the servers and a higher likelihood of successfully initiating the Beeper Mini free trial without encountering server-related errors.

What causes error code DF-DFERH-01 in Beeper Mini?

As the error message suggests, error code DF-DFERH-01 in Beeper Mini typically occurs when the application is unable to retrieve the requested information from the server within a specified time frame.

This server connection issue can arise due to various reasons, such as server overloads, connectivity problems, or temporary outages, which hinder the app's ability to communicate effectively with the server.

For Beeper Mini, the DF-DFERH-01 error is due to server overload, unable to handle the high volume of user requests. This results in the error being displayed to users when the server capacity is exceeded.
